River Birch Trimming in Allentown, PA
River Birch trimming services involve carefully shaping and reducing the size of river birch trees to promote healthy growth and maintain the desired appearance of a property. This type of pruning can address overgrown branches, remove damaged or diseased limbs, and improve overall tree structure. Projects often include selective thinning, crown reduction, or shaping to ensure the trees remain safe and aesthetically pleasing, especially in residential landscapes where trees are a prominent feature.
Property owners typically seek river birch trimming services to enhance the safety and beauty of their outdoor spaces. Before requesting this service, it is helpful to understand the current condition of the trees, including any signs of disease or damage, and to consider the desired outcome-whether for safety, health, or visual appeal. Proper trimming can also improve air circulation and light penetration, contributing to the overall health of the trees and the landscape.

River Birch Trimming Questions
What is the purpose of trimming river birch trees? Trimming helps maintain the tree's health, shape, and safety by removing damaged or overgrown branches.
When is the best time to trim river birch trees? The ideal time for trimming is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.
Why should property owners consider professional river birch trimming? Professionals ensure proper technique, reducing the risk of damage and promoting healthy growth.
What types of trimming projects are common for river birch trees? Common projects include crown thinning, shaping, removing dead wood, and clearing away branches near structures.
